DEPARTMENT PURPOSE
The City Attorney's Office advises and represents all city elected and appointed officials, departments, employees, boards, committees, and commissions on all civil legal matters pertaining to municipal law and the City of Spokane. 

POSITION PURPOSE
Play integral role for all municipal law involving the City.

SUPERVISION EXERCISED
Works independently subject to guidance by City Attorney or Senior Attorneys. May supervise junior attorneys and support staff in specific projects or areas of expertise.
 Assistant City Attorneys have the unique opportunity to develop specialization in various areas of municipal law such as land use/planning, human resource/labor law, and/or utilities/public works.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Engage in a broad range of legal representation of all city departments, officials and employees.
  • Conduct legal research and provide oral and written opinions on major substantive, procedural, and administrative issues to City departments, boards, and commissions.
  • Draft ordinances, resolutions, regulations, contracts, proposals for state legislation and other legal documents. 
  • Attend meetings of the City Council and City boards and commissions as the legal advisor to the City officials and governing body. 
  • Analyze changes in state and federal laws and court decisions and provide legal guidance to City departments for compliance with new requirements.
  • Provide legal assistance and guidance to other attorneys within specific areas of expertise.
  • Conduct independent legal research, render oral and written opinions on major substantive, procedural, and administrative issues to major City departments, boards, and commissions.
  • Draft, review, and assist in the administration of City contracts and other procurement.
  • Prepare and conduct major litigation before federal, state, and local courts, and administrative agencies and other adjudicative bodies.
  • Negotiate and recommend settlement of claims filed against the City.
  • Analyze changes in state and federal laws and court decisions and provide legal guidance to City departments as to method of compliance with new requirements.
  • Provide legal assistance and guidance to other attorneys within specific area of expertise.
  • Participate as active member (non-legal role) in various City administrative and management projects.

WORKING CONDITIONS
Work is conducted primarily in an office setting. It involves frequent attendance at meetings to include some irregular hours and potentially out-of-town travel. Incumbents in this classification are expected to communicate verbally, in person, and by telephone. A computer terminal is used and requires the use of repetitive arm-hand movements.
Education:
Juris doctor or equivalent degree. Membership in Washington State Bar Association.

Experience:
Five (5) years' experience in practice of law required, with three (3) years' experience in municipal law recommended. Member of the Washington State Bar Association.

BEHAVIORAL STANDARDS
As an exempt employee of the City of Spokane, the Assistant City Attorney III is subject to the City’s Code of Ethics set forth in Chapter 1.04A of the Spokane Municipal Code. As such, “it is the policy of the City of Spokane to uphold, promote, and demand the highest standards of ethics from all of its employees who shall maintain the utmost standards of responsibility, trustworthiness, integrity, truthfulness, honesty and fairness in carrying out their public duties, avoid any improprieties in their roles as a public servant including the appearance of impropriety, and never use their City position, authority or resources for personal gain.”
